The Lewisburg Foundation has announced that the 2020-21 Postman’s Pants Tomfoolery Competition ended on April Fools’ Day.
Approximately $700 was donated this year to be given to the local charity chosen by the winner. However, the contest was determined to be a tie between Lewisburg Mail Carriers Bernie Holliday and Nathan Good.
Holliday chose his $350 to be donated to the Family Refuge Center and Good awarded his $350 to Greenbrier Valley Aquatic Center.
“Thank you, gentlemen, for bringing some fun and light to each day of winter,” said TAG Galyean, Lewisburg Foundation Board of Directors president.
